
Career
- 1989- Professor of Theoretical Geophysics, University of Cambridge
- 1970- Fellow, King's College, Cambridge
- 1988-1989 Reader in Geophysical Dynamics
- 1981-1988 University Lecturer
- 1970-1981 Assistant Director of Research in DAMTP, Cambridge
- 1968-1969 ICI Research Fellow at Cambridge University
At various times visiting scientist at the Australian National University, University of California at San Diego, Canterbury University, Caltech, MIT, University of New South Wales, University of Sydney, Tata Institute at Mumbai, University of Western Australia, the Weizmann Institute and the Woods Hole Oceanographic Institute.
Research
- Carbon dioxide sequestration
- The flow of granular media
- Constrained lava flows
- Exchange flows
- The fluid mechanics of solidification
- The sinking of pumice
